Jesus Christ, our King of glory,we have not been outspoken for you.We have not called for your death,but neither have we shouted of your greatness,nor expressed delight in the salvation you have won for us.Help us to see your glory, draw us closer to youthat we may become more faithful and more joyfulservants of the King. The first Sunday of Holy Week is commonly called either "Palm Sunday" or "Passion Sunday." Those who call it "Palm Sunday" tend to focus on the entry of Christ into Jerusalem to the shouts of "Hosanna!
